TIGS, founded in 2017, is a non-profit research institute that aspires to develop solutions to challenges in human health and agriculture. TIGS is a unique initiative to support applications of cutting-edge science and technology in genetics and genomics to solve societal problems of the country. The most significant challenges that impede the achievement of health equity and nutrition security for all of India’s population require systematic evidence-based scientific advancements and technological solutions.
